How enjoyable the Christmas season is, and when you give a book as a gift for Christmas this year, why not place a Christmas book label on the inside? You can place recipient's name on the Christmas bookplate along with the year it was given.
If you are sending a book to a friend for the Holidays, be sure to print a set of matching address labels for your Holiday gift package, including your name and address preprinted in a fun or elegant style font face. Add a special Christmas image on your Christmas address labels too.
You can make a set of Christmas bookplates of varying sizes and position the book label text on the bookplate above or below an image, like the book label below:

Personalized bookplates are so much fun to use and when you receive a book, think of how nice it is to open the front cover and read a special message on a custom bookplate that was customized and made just for you from a dear friend of yours. Kind of makes a book gift extra special, don't you think? Be sure to make some extra gift personalized bookplates for those special Christmas book gifts you will be giving friends this year.
